The Memorial Day Weekend kicked off with a bang at the Ledge Amphitheater as Brantley Gilbert's "Tattoos" Tour opened the 2026 season. Despite the rain and cooler temperatures, fans eagerly lined up to enjoy the show. General Manager Meredith Lyon and her staff were thrilled to kick off the season with such an exciting event. The first show required extra preparation as the staff had to de-winterize the facility.

The concert began with Payton Smith, who played a 15-minute set featuring upbeat tunes and a tribute to the late NASCAR Driver Kyle Bush. Following a short intermission, Aaron Lewis and the Stateliners took the stage, engaging with fans between songs and playing hits like "God and Guns" and a cover of Staind's "It's Been Awhile." Brantley Gilbert took the stage after a 30-minute break, delivering a high-energy performance with a mix of classic hits and new songs like "Good Die Young."

The rain subsided by the end of the night, providing a fun and memorable evening of country music at the Ledge. Upcoming shows at the venue include The Little River Band on June 6th and Lee Brice on June 12th. Check out the photo gallery from the concert below to relive the excitement of the event.
